Transaction 644400fd789cb25cf4ce3ed8bf9558dc555202851e22def3dce49c5ce071ae5f
1 Input
1 Output
-
644400fd789cb25cf4ce3ed8bf9558dc555202851e22def3dce49c5ce071ae5f:0
- value
- 1367670
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bbbb50a3b8efe4f254d562c9107369d70ba26167 OP_EQUAL
- address
- 3JoegHnmVHG82r8RC5J933JzaBMD5p6VXB